Kaybe is a contemporary name often regarded as a creative and unique unisex choice. It likely derives as a phonetic variant or blend inspired by names such as 'Kaye' or 'Kay' combined with a modern suffix '-be,' giving it a fresh, inventive feel. While it lacks deep historical roots, its modern usage emphasizes individuality and artistic expression in naming trends.
Though Kaybe does not have ancient cultural roots, its rise coincides with modern naming trends favoring originality and gender neutrality. It reflects a shift towards personalized names that are easy to pronounce, memorable, and adaptable across different cultures. The name fits well within contemporary movements embracing fluidity in gender and identity through naming.
Kaybe is gaining traction among parents seeking a distinctive, unisex name that stands out without being difficult to spell or pronounce. Its modern feel aligns with current trends favoring non-traditional, creative names that avoid strong ties to a single culture or gender. While not yet widespread, it is popular in English-speaking countries among millennial and Gen Z parents.
